Best 47265 Indiana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public elementary schools serving 1,254 students in 47265, IN.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in 47265, IN are Brush Creek Elementary School, North Vernon Elementary School and Sand Creek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 47265 have an average math proficiency score of 37% (versus the Indiana public elementary school average of 41%), and reading proficiency score of 29% (versus the 40% statewide average). Elementary schools in 47265, IN have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Indiana public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 13%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Indiana public elementary school average of 38% (majority Hispanic and Black).
